Shut Up, Stop Whining & Get a Life

This is not your typical self-help book. You won’t find any motivational platitudes or cute business parables here. This is more of a “get off your butt and get to work” approach that can help you achieve more success, make more money, improve your business, and have more fun.

Larry Winget doesn’t pull any punches here. He believes that business gets better when businesspeople get better through personal growth. And it works the same way in your personal life-husbands and wives improve each other when they improve themselves, and kids improve when their parents do. In other words, everything in life gets better when you get better, and nothing gets better until you get better.

This book can make you better, but it will probably tick you off. Winget is direct, caustic, and controversial. You won’t like or agree with everything he has to say. Yet his advice is full of wisdom and truth that can’t easily be argued with.

This book is about making your life better. If you really want to make your life better, along the way you are going to have to come to terms with the reality that life isn’t always fair and having to admit things about yourself, to yourself, isn’t easy. But if you want to grow, it is necessary to face reality and go about making some changes in your life.

You can decide to try to improve your life, but until you take action, all you have done is made a decision. Maybe you’ve heard the riddle; five birds are sitting on a fence and one decides to fly away. How many birds are on the fence? The answer is still five. The one bird only decided to fly away, but until the bird actually takes flight, he is still sitting on the fence! Winget gives the reader actionable steps to use to get off the fence.

The book is heavy on quotes and covers a wide array of topics from business, relationships, health, spirituality and social issues. You won’t agree with all the author has to say, but you will find guidance to things you are willing to admit and want to change.
